Delphinium http://Delphin.notlong.com 15 June 2007 Delphinium This delphinium was planted in 2004, and it gave one small spike the first year. Since then, it has produced more spikes yearly. A shovel full of compost is put on top each year. It starts growing in the spring when there is still snow on the ground. When the first flowering is done, it is cut back to ground level, and there will be new blooms later in the season. These are not as spectacular as the first bloom, but still attractive. http://www.durgan.org/Blog/Durgan.html
